Current Data Minutes: Click here to view the recording of this item on YouTube.
The Senior Housing Manager presented the current data to the Task Group.
The Chair invited questions and comments from the Task Group, a summary which is set out below.
Councillor Bubb referred to 174 homeless applications taken in Quarter 3 and sought clarification on any applications which had been removed from the list as housing was found.
The Senior Housing Manager explained to the Task Group, a person may contact the housing department informally and not apply. He added approximately 20% of applications are withdrawn as homelessness may have been resolved independently. He highlighted this would be dependent on circumstances and likelihood of success.
In response to Councillor Kemp’s question, the Senior Housing Manager confirmed that the Housing First service provided an intensive level of support and explained once tenants moved out of Housing First accommodation, support continues, and the service provided open ended in line with the need.
